Output 70ed142ce8dc4df35668346a55a42b38d0eca3d615ab2b8721ea7dbe9b9a7cc2:3

value
206000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5d0b0e4fc315e54cea134e9fb446e3aa00c4596 OP_EQUAL
address
3MBZrWRWbKGCrAwVNawyBsxotgfDBbg9f5
transaction
70ed142ce8dc4df35668346a55a42b38d0eca3d615ab2b8721ea7dbe9b9a7cc2
spent
true